dubiousintent Posted March 17, 2017 Share Posted March 17, 2017 Yes, it's not normal behavior and likely a mod conflict. We can't do anything without information as to what you are using. It's always useful to post your "Load Order" (LO) with your problem description. (Use the "Special BBCode" button in the Forum "Reply" menu bar as the third icon from the left in the top row, next to and left of the "Font" pick-list field to put the LO in "Spoiler" tags.) Screenshots are not the best way to convey your LO, because they usually can't include everything in one image. LOOT can copy your LO into a list suitable for posting on forums. (It's under the ":" with three dots to the extreme right in it's menu bar.) Most "mod managers" have a similar "LO List" capability. But the total number of mods you have installed in the DATA folder is also important, because even inactive plugins are counted against the so-called "140 cap". LOOT provides both numbers: active and total installed. -Dubious-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

dubiousintent Posted March 17, 2017 Share Posted March 17, 2017 Suggest you read the wiki article "FNV General Mod Use Advice" first. When there are multiple optional files that are variations of the same thing, you have to choose only one of them. Usually such mods have a wizard or require use of a specific mod manager (or the knowledge of how to correctly repackage them) to install correctly. Specifically, you have all the optional XFO files where you should have chosen only one of each, as for example:44 2c XFO - 3ce - rarity - meds - easier.esp45 2d XFO - 3cd - rarity - meds - vanilla.esp46 2e XFO - 3cc - rarity - meds - hard.esp47 2f XFO - 3cb - rarity - meds - med.esp All four of these files are an option for one element of the game and you only should install one of them. This needs to be corrected through out your "load order". Note that this means you need to uninstall ALL of XFO (not merely "disable" because they overwrote themselves and possibly other files), "verify local files" from Steam, and reinstall all your mods.
